|
Как правильно указывать параметры запроса на сервере?
| ☑ |
0
MAPATNK2
naïve
11.03.22
✎
12:47
|
Всем доброго дня. есть какие то правила по указанию параметров запроса на сервере?
В реквизитах объекта есть "номенклатурная группа".
Если я прям "НаСервере" пишу :
Запрос.УстановитьПараметры("НГ", Объект.НоменклатураняГруппа);
Является ли это ошибкой? Может мне нужно использовать НаСервереБезКонтекста, а параметры передавать с клиента? Но будет ли увеличение производительности в таком случае,
ведь мне все равно нужно будет обращаться к "Объект.НоменклатураняГруппа"...
Подписки на ИТС нет, на справку сайта 1С зайти не могу.
|
|
1
MAPATNK2
naïve
11.03.22
✎
12:53
|
Может есть какой то свод правил по работе с клиентСервером, где явно указано, что где делать нужно, а что можно, но не стоит с точки зрения производительности.
|
|
2
lubitelxml
11.03.22
✎
12:54
|
С точки зрения производительности если на сервере тебе нужна только НоменклатураняГруппа, то передавай ее в параметр, и не тащи весь объект на сервер, а используй НаСервереБезКонтекста
|
|
3
lubitelxml
11.03.22
✎
12:56
|
Я вообще стараюсь где возможно использовать НаСервереБезКонтекста, так как высоконагруженную систему разрабатываю
|
|
4
MAPATNK2
naïve
11.03.22
✎
12:59
|
(2) Передавать нужно будет 5 объектов из 6. 5 реквизитов. 1 Таблица, которая не нужна на сервер. Имеет ли смысл передавать 5 на СерверБезКонтекста...
|
|
5
MAPATNK2
naïve
11.03.22
✎
13:04
|
Всем спасибо. Суть ясна.
|
|
6
lubitelxml
11.03.22
✎
13:04
|
(4) таблица может быть 1 строка, а может 10000, я бы запихнул все 5 реквизитов в структуру и передал без контекста
|
|
7
lodger
11.03.22
✎
13:38
|
(6) а потом результат запроса пихать в эту таблицу...
|
|
8
lubitelxml
11.03.22
✎
15:27
|
(7) ну тут непонятно - что должно вернутся
|
|